Material Selection and Finishes
The choice of materials plays a critical role in the final appearance and durability of the fixture. Galvanized steel provides a matte, gun-metal gray finish that is perfect for urban or minimalist decors. For a warmer touch, polished brass or antique bronze finishes can be used, which develop a rich patina over time. Copper tubing is another popular option, offering a natural transition from a shiny metallic surface to an elegant verdigris patina, adding depth and history to the piece.

- Galvanized Iron: Highly durable, resistant to rust, and ideal for modern lofts.
- Brass & Bronze: Offers a classic, warm glow and ages beautifully with use.
- Copper: Provides excellent thermal conductivity and a unique aesthetic evolution.
Functional Advantages and Customization
Beyond aesthetics, the modular nature of these lamps offers significant practical benefits. The threaded piping system allows for easy assembly, disassembly, and adjustment. If a user desires a taller pendant, additional nipples and couplings can be integrated seamlessly. Furthermore, the ability to direct light precisely where it is needed—downward for task lighting or omnidirectionally for ambient mood lighting—is a distinct advantage over fixed-shade fixtures.
Customization Possibilities
True versatility lies in the adaptability of the design. These lamps are not confined to a single shape or size. They can be configured as linear pipe lights to illuminate a kitchen counter, assembled into a dense cluster for a dramatic chandelier effect, or shaped into an organic form that mimics natural growth. The ability to mix different pipe diameters and angles means that no two installations are truly identical, allowing the fixture to be a true bespoke element of the interior design.
| Configuration | Best For | Light Distribution |
|---|---|---|
| Linear/Straight | Kitchen Islands, Desks | Focused, Task-oriented |
| Cluster/Drum | Dining Rooms, Entryways | Ambient, 360-degree |
| Angled/Artistic | Feature Walls, Bedrooms | Accent, Directional |

Installation Considerations and Safety
While the aesthetic appeal is strong, proper installation is paramount to ensure safety and longevity. Because these fixtures are often heavier than standard ceiling lights, they require a secure junction box rated for the weight. It is essential to turn off the power at the breaker before beginning any electrical work. For those who prefer a polished look, covering the wiring with additional conduit or tubing not only enhances the industrial look but also protects the cables from physical damage.
